Food & Dining in Pasar Kliwon

Pasar Kliwon, located within the culturally rich city of Solo, offers a culinary landscape that is as diverse and captivating as its heritage. The region is celebrated for its distinct Javanese cuisine, with dishes that have been perfected over generations. From the sweet and savory flavors of Gudeg Solo to the hearty Nasi Liwet, the local food scene is a delightful exploration for any palate. International visitors will find a unique gastronomic journey here, characterized by aromatic spices, tender meats, and a comforting blend of textures and tastes that define authentic Indonesian cooking.

For travellers seeking authentic local flavours, Pasar Kliwon and its surrounding neighbourhoods provide a wealth of dining experiences. The bustling markets, particularly those within the Pasar Kliwon district itself, are prime spots for sampling street food and local delicacies. Areas like Kauman and Kedung Lumbu also offer charming eateries and warungs where traditional dishes are served with genuine Javanese hospitality. Muslim travellers will find that many establishments in Pasar Kliwon offer Halal-certified options, ensuring a comfortable and inclusive dining experience for all visitors.

The cost of dining in Pasar Kliwon offers exceptional value for international travellers. Street food and meals at local warungs can be enjoyed for as little as ₱ 50 to ₱ 150 (approximately $1 to $3 USD), making it incredibly affordable to sample a wide variety of dishes. Mid-range restaurants typically charge between ₱ 200 to ₱ 500 (approximately $4 to $10 USD) per person for a full meal, while more upscale dining experiences might range from ₱ 600 to ₱ 1,000 (approximately $12 to $20 USD) or more. This affordability allows visitors to indulge in the local cuisine extensively.

Navigating dining etiquette in Pasar Kliwon is straightforward and contributes to a pleasant experience. It is customary to eat with your right hand, especially when dining at more traditional establishments or enjoying street food. Tipping is not mandatory but is appreciated for excellent service, typically around 5-10% of the bill. Meal times generally follow Indonesian patterns, with lunch being the main meal of the day, usually between 12 PM and 2 PM. Being open to trying new flavours and showing appreciation for the food and service will be well-received by local hosts.

Local Etiquette & Safety in Pasar Kliwon

Understanding local customs and etiquette is key to a respectful and enjoyable visit to Pasar Kliwon. Javanese culture places a high value on politeness, respect, and maintaining harmony. When interacting with locals, a gentle demeanor and a polite greeting, such as "Selamat pagi" (Good morning) or "Terima kasih" (Thank you), go a long way. It's considered polite to use your right hand for giving and receiving items, and to avoid pointing with a single finger, instead using an open hand. Dressing modestly, especially when visiting religious sites or more traditional areas, is also appreciated.

When visiting popular landmarks like Luwes Gading or the vicinity of Amira, maintaining respectful behaviour is important. While Luwes Gading is a commercial centre, dressing neatly is advisable. For cultural sites, modest attire is recommended, covering shoulders and knees. Photography is generally permitted, but it's always courteous to ask for permission before taking close-up photos of individuals, especially in more traditional settings. Queuing culture is generally observed, and patience is a virtue when navigating busy areas or waiting for services.

Pasar Kliwon is generally a safe destination for international travellers, with low crime rates. However, as with any travel, it's wise to take standard precautions. Keep your valuables secure and be aware of your surroundings, particularly in crowded markets. For transportation, reputable ride-hailing apps like Grab are widely available and offer a convenient and relatively safe way to get around. Familiarizing yourself with basic Indonesian phrases can also be helpful for communication and navigating local transport options effectively.

In case of emergencies, local police can be contacted via emergency numbers. For medical assistance, inquire at your hotel for the nearest reputable clinic or hospital. Travel Guide to Pasar Kliwon

Reaching Pasar Kliwon from the Philippines is a journey that typically involves flights from major hubs like Manila (NAIA/MNL), Cebu (CEB), or Clark (CRK). While direct flights to the nearest airport serving Pasar Kliwon, Adisumarmo International Airport (SOC) in Surakarta, are less common, connecting flights through hubs like Singapore, Kuala Lumpur, or Jakarta are readily available. The total travel time can range from 8 to 15 hours, depending on the layover duration. Booking your book flight in advance, especially during peak seasons, can secure better fares, often starting from ₱ 15,000 to ₱ 25,000 round trip.

Once you arrive at Adisumarmo International Airport (SOC), getting to Pasar Kliwon is straightforward. Taxis and ride-sharing services are readily available at the airport and offer a convenient transfer to your accommodation, with the journey taking approximately 30-45 minutes and costing around ₱ 200-₱ 300 (approximately $4-$6 USD). Within Pasar Kliwon, local transportation options include 'becak' (cycle rickshaws) for short distances, 'ojek' (motorcycle taxis), and the ubiquitous ride-sharing apps, which are efficient and affordable for navigating the city and its various neighbourhoods.

The best time to visit Pasar Kliwon generally aligns with Indonesia's dry season, which typically runs from May to September. During these months, you can expect pleasant weather with lower humidity and minimal rainfall, ideal for outdoor exploration and sightseeing. While this period might see slightly higher hotel prices and more tourists, it offers the most comfortable conditions. The shoulder months of April and October can also be good options, offering a balance of decent weather and fewer crowds, making them attractive for travellers seeking a more relaxed experience.

Before embarking on your trip to Pasar Kliwon, a few pre-departure preparations will ensure a smooth journey. The local currency is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R), but major currencies like USD are sometimes accepted in tourist-oriented establishments, though exchanging money to IDR is recommended for daily expenses. SIM cards with data plans can be purchased at the airport or in local shops for easy connectivity. Essential apps include Google Maps for navigation, a translation app, and ride-sharing applications. Ensure your passport has at least six months of validity remaining and carry copies of important documents.

Visa Information for Indonesia

For Philippine passport holders planning to visit Indonesia to explore Pasar Kliwon, understanding the visa requirements is crucial. As of current regulations, Philippine citizens are generally granted visa-free entry into Indonesia for short stays, typically up to 30 days. This allows for convenient travel for tourism purposes without the need for a pre-arranged visa. However, it is always recommended to verify the latest visa policies with the Indonesian Embassy or Consulate in the Philippines, as regulations can be subject to change.

The visa-free entry for Filipino travellers usually requires a valid passport with at least six months of remaining validity from the date of entry. Additionally, travellers may be asked to present proof of onward travel, such as a return or onward flight ticket, and sometimes proof of sufficient funds to cover their stay. While no visa fee is associated with this visa-free facility, any extensions or stays beyond the permitted duration will require proper application and may incur fees and penalties.

It is imperative for all travellers, including those from the Philippines, to confirm the most current visa regulations directly with Indonesia's official immigration authorities or the Indonesian Embassy in their country of residence before making any travel arrangements. Policies regarding entry requirements, permitted lengths of stay, and any necessary documentation can be updated without prior notice. Ensuring your visa status is confirmed before you book flight will prevent any last-minute complications.
